Display Quality

The display is a crucial aspect of any laptop, and the Dell Inspiron fifty six forty five generally features a screen size that’s suitable for everyday tasks and multimedia consumption. The resolution is often Full HD, which offers a decent level of sharpness for viewing text and images.

The panel type is an important consideration. TN panels are sometimes used in budget-friendly configurations, offering fast response times but potentially sacrificing viewing angles and color accuracy. IPS panels, on the other hand, generally provide wider viewing angles and more vibrant colors, making them preferable for tasks like photo editing or watching videos.

Brightness is another factor. A brighter display is easier to view in well-lit environments. The Inspiron fifty six forty five’s display brightness is typically adequate for indoor use, but it may struggle in direct sunlight. Color accuracy is generally acceptable for casual use but might not meet the demands of professional graphic designers or photographers. Performance Under the Hood

The processing power of the Dell Inspiron fifty six forty five stems from its use of AMD Ryzen processors. You’ll likely find various models within the Ryzen family powering different configurations of this laptop. The specific Ryzen processor will significantly impact the laptop’s overall performance.

RAM, or Random Access Memory, plays a vital role in multitasking. The amount of RAM determines how many applications you can run simultaneously without experiencing slowdowns. Common RAM configurations in the Inspiron fifty six forty five include eight gigabytes or sixteen gigabytes.

Storage is another critical aspect. The type of storage drive can significantly impact boot times and application loading speeds. Solid state drives, or SSDs, are significantly faster than traditional hard disk drives, or HDDs. Some configurations of the Inspiron fifty six forty five may feature an SSD as the primary storage drive, while others may utilize an HDD for more storage capacity at a lower cost. A combination of both an SSD and an HDD is also possible, offering a balance of speed and storage space.

Graphics processing is handled by integrated AMD Radeon graphics. This means that the graphics processing unit, or GPU, is integrated into the processor, rather than being a separate, dedicated graphics card. Integrated graphics are suitable for everyday tasks and light gaming but are not ideal for demanding gaming or graphics-intensive applications.
